Ab maj7(b5)(sus)/Bb

The Ab maj7(b5)(sus) chord consists of the Ab (Perfect unison), Ebb (Diminished fifth) and G (Major seventh) notes, with Bb as the bass note.

Piano keyboard showing the notes for a Ab maj7(b5)(sus)/Bb chord

How to play the Ab maj7(b5)(sus)/Bb chord

  1. Play Bb as the lowest bass note in the left hand
  2. Find Ab (Root) on the piano keyboard
  3. Add Ebb (Diminished fifth) — 6 semitones above Ab
  4. Add G (Major seventh) — 11 semitones above Ab
  5. Press all 4 notes simultaneously to sound the Ab maj7(b5)(sus)/Bb chord
